What are the dust – prevention measures for engineering vehicle series?

Dust is an inevitable by – product in the operation of engineering vehicles. It not only affects the working environment but also has a negative impact on the health of operators and the service life of the vehicles themselves. 1. Vehicle Design and Structure Optimization

Sealed Cabins

One of the most basic and effective dust – prevention measures is to design sealed cabins for engineering vehicles. A well – sealed cabin can prevent dust from entering the interior where the operator is located. We use high – quality sealing materials around the doors, windows, and other openings of the cabin. These materials are designed to withstand the harsh working environment of engineering vehicles. For example, the rubber seals we use have excellent elasticity and durability, which can effectively block dust particles even in high – wind and high – dust conditions.

Air Filtration Systems

Installing advanced air filtration systems in the vehicle is crucial. These systems can filter out dust and other harmful particles from the air entering the cabin. Our engineering vehicles are equipped with multi – stage air filters. The first stage usually consists of a pre – filter that can capture large dust particles. Then, the air passes through a high – efficiency particulate air (HEPA) filter, which can remove fine dust particles with a high degree of efficiency. This ensures that the air inside the cabin is clean and breathable for the operator.

Enclosed Cargo Areas

For engineering vehicles that carry materials such as sand, gravel, or coal, enclosed cargo areas can significantly reduce dust emissions. We design the cargo areas with tight – fitting covers and seals. These covers can be opened and closed easily for loading and unloading operations. By enclosing the cargo, we prevent dust from being blown away during transportation, reducing the dust pollution in the surrounding environment.

2. Maintenance and Cleaning

Regular Cleaning of Vehicle Surfaces

Dust can accumulate on the surface of engineering vehicles over time. Regular cleaning of the vehicle body, wheels, and other components is necessary to prevent the dust from becoming a source of secondary pollution. We recommend that vehicle owners clean their vehicles at least once a week. This can be done using high – pressure water guns or steam cleaners. Special attention should be paid to areas such as the radiator grille and the engine compartment, where dust can easily accumulate and affect the performance of the vehicle.

Filter Replacement

The air filters in engineering vehicles need to be replaced regularly. The frequency of replacement depends on the working environment of the vehicle. In high – dust environments, the filters may need to be replaced every few months. We provide clear instructions to our customers on how to replace the filters correctly. By replacing the filters in a timely manner, we ensure that the air filtration system continues to function effectively.

Lubrication and Sealing Inspection

Regular inspection of the lubrication and sealing parts of the vehicle is also important. Dust can enter the vehicle through damaged seals or poorly lubricated parts. We recommend that vehicle owners check the seals around the doors, windows, and engine compartments regularly. If any damage is found, the seals should be replaced immediately. In addition, proper lubrication of moving parts can prevent dust from adhering to them and causing wear and tear.

3. Operational Measures

Speed Control

Driving at a reasonable speed can reduce dust emissions. When the vehicle is moving at a high speed, the wheels can kick up a large amount of dust. By reducing the speed, especially on unpaved roads or in areas with loose soil, we can significantly reduce the amount of dust generated. We advise our customers to adjust the speed according to the road conditions and the nature of the work.

Route Planning

Planning the route in advance can also help to reduce dust exposure. Avoiding dusty areas such as construction sites or unpaved roads as much as possible can minimize the amount of dust that the vehicle is exposed to. We provide our customers with mapping tools and advice on route planning to help them choose the cleanest and safest routes.

Loading and Unloading Operations

During loading and unloading operations, it is important to take measures to reduce dust emissions. For example, when loading materials, we can use water spraying systems to moisten the materials, which can reduce the amount of dust generated. When unloading, we can also use similar water spraying methods to suppress dust. In addition, the loading and unloading areas should be kept clean and free of dust.

4. Technological Innovations

Dust Suppression Systems

We are constantly researching and developing new dust suppression systems for our engineering vehicles. One of the latest technologies we are using is the electrostatic dust suppression system. This system uses an electrostatic field to attract dust particles, which are then collected and removed. This technology can effectively reduce dust emissions in a wide range of working environments.

Sensor – Based Monitoring

We are also incorporating sensor – based monitoring systems into our engineering vehicles. These sensors can detect the level of dust in the air and on the vehicle surface. Based on the data collected by the sensors, the vehicle can automatically adjust its dust – prevention measures. For example, if the dust level is too high, the air filtration system can be adjusted to a higher filtration level.
